Optimize various aggregate deserialization functions The serialized representation of an internal aggregate state is a bytea value. In each deserial function, in order to "receive" the bytea value we appended it onto a short-lived StringInfoData using appendBinaryStringInfo. This was a little wasteful as it meant having to palloc memory, copy a (possibly long) series of bytes then later pfree that memory. Instead of going to this extra trouble, we can just fake up a StringInfoData and point the data directly at the bytea's payload. This should help increase the performance of internal aggregate deserialization.
